gitana Posted January 19, 2016 Share #4 Posted January 19, 2016 I would think it's an ACH because it lacks the side chinstrap rivets of the PASGT. That being said, does it have any of the markings normally found in an ACH? If it doesn't have the usual markings, or the usual label, it may very well be a test helmet. Or an unfinished one. There are some test PASGT helmets floating around that look unfinished, but they are devoid of any crown markings inherent in the production models.
